Welcome to Splitgate, our A/B assignment service. Quick basics: assignments are sticky per user hash, so never re-bucket mid-experiment — it wrecks the stats. If assignments look skewed, check the salt rotation job first; it's the usual culprit. Config changes go through the Splitgate admin UI, never straight to the database. When filing an incident, grab the active config version from the health endpoint and paste the trace token printed below it.

session token of bawep-yadup = htk21_528abd376e3c5a4ec24a1

The Lanternway app handles deep links through the RouteWeaver module, which maps inbound URIs to screen controllers via the table in `routes.yaml`. New routes must be registered in both the iOS and Android manifests, then validated with the link-simulator tool before merge. Note that universal-link association files are served from the edge config, not the app bundle, so changes there require a separate deploy. That deploy pipeline verifies each push against our association signing key, reproduced here for reference.

release key, fahaf-bajof: bky3_Xam

Ticket #2205 — Vault sealed; timezone export fix blocked

The Gantline reporting vault sealed itself after the scheduled key rotation, blocking verification of the timezone fix: exports previously stamped UTC offsets using the server locale rather than the tenant setting. Please audit the unseal event carefully. The vault's recovery passphrase is recorded immediately below.

unlock words, hahip-baduf: holwyn-istath-julvan